We initially chose the resort for its beautiful and spacious pool area. The grounds around the free-form main pool look down a gentle slope to a spectacular beach -- a memorable sight. Even when the hotel was full, there were always plenty of lounge chairs. The adult pool really meant it. Half the people there seemed absorbed in their Kindles... More

The rooms at the Fairmont are huge, though the decorating could use an update. The bathrooms are very well-appointed and include a separate stand-up shower and soaking bath. The large entryway include a giant wet-bar, microwave, and mini-fridge. We had a top-floor suite with amazing views of the water and the sunset. Though we were back from the water we... More
